Sara Evans is hitting the road again this winter for the The Holiday Road Tour. The country star will kick off her 10-city tour Dec. 2 in Cranston, Rhode Island, before wrapping up Dec. 18 in Des Moines, Iowa. Pit stops along the way include Albany, Green Bay, and Des Moines.

The Holiday Road Tour has become an annual tradition during the December holiday season for the singer-songwriter. The shows treat fans to classic Evans hits, like her chart-topping “Born to Fly” and “A Little Bit Stronger,” as well as holiday favorites, all performed with her live band.

North Carolina native Braden Hull, a former firefighter who’s quickly making his mark on Nashville, will be on hand for support.

Evans’ road to Nashville stardom began with a demo of Buck Owens’ “I’ve Got a Tiger by the Tail,” which caught the attention of legendary songwriter Harlan Howard back in the ’90s. She then signed with RCA Nashville and released her debut album, Three Chords and the Truth, in July 1997.

Though only a modest commercial success, the record and its neo-traditional country sound drew comparisons to Patsy Cline and earned Evans a ton of critical praise, with Rolling Stone calling it “Nashville’s most unjustly ignored debut.”

Shifting to a more contemporary country-pop sound for her next album, 1999’s No Place That Far, Evans scored her first No. 1 on the Billboard country charts with her title track, featuring Vince Gill. Evans then entered her superstar era in 2000 with Born to Fly, which went double platinum and produced the title track that earned CMA Video of the Year.

Riding the momentum, Evans released Real Fine Place in 2005, which debuted at No. 1 on the Top Country Albums chart. That success was repeated in 2011 with Stronger. In October 2023, she achieved a lifelong dream when she was officially inducted into the Grand Ole Opry.

Evans’ latest album, Unbroke, was released in June 2024, with breakout single “21 Days” and lead track “Pride” becoming fan favorites. The powerhouse vocalist is currently on the road performing shows coast to coast as she gets ready for the holidays.
